Exceptional Parser Changes, posted on Tue Sep 21 22:37:57 2010
Posted by: Woom
Category: Mudlib
The parser has been changed a bit, more specifically how "except" is handled.

"except" is now handled before comma, "and" and ampersand. This means that "a&b except c&d", which used to match "a and ( b except c ) and d" now matches "( a and b ) except ( c and d )".

Furthermore, matching with "except" will no longer fail if the excepted class doesn't exist. That is, rather than fail, "a except b" will match all of a if there are no b.
